    The Role

  • 1. To what extent did you enjoy your work placement or internship?
  • I was instantly welcomed by everyone and was given exciting work to do.

    4/5

  • 2. To what extent did you feel valued by your colleagues?
  • Everyone made great effort to welcome me and make sure I wasn't having any problems.

    5/5

  • 3. To what extent were you given support and guidance by management/your supervisor(s)?
  • I was given excellent support from my manager, we had regular one-to-one meetings to discuss how I was getting on and she approachable if I had any problems between meetings.

    5/5

  • 4. How busy were you on a daily basis?
  • The level of work varied greatly for me - some days I was extremely busy and others I had very little to do, but this was just due to the nature of the role I was in and didn't mean my time working in this role wasn't enjoyable.

    3/5

  • 5. How much responsibility were you given during your placement?
  • I was given a fair amount of responsibility to manage tasks and projects by myself but there was always the opportunity to ask for help if it was needed.

    4/5

  • 6. To what extent did/will the skills you developed, and training you received, assist you in your degree studies and beyond?
  • The knowledge and skills I developed during my internship will be very usefull in my degree studies and beyond. I was able to develop skills that will be transferable in other aspects of my life.

    4/5
